public class OrganizationQueryType extends RegistryObjectQueryType
Java class for OrganizationQueryType complex type.
The following schema fragment specifies the expected content contained within this class.
<complexType name="OrganizationQueryType"> <complexContent> <extension base="{urn:oasis:names:tc:ebxml-regrep:xsd:query:3.0}RegistryObjectQueryType"> <sequence> <element name="AddressFilter" type="{urn:oasis:names:tc:ebxml-regrep:xsd:query:3.0}FilterType" maxOccurs="unbounded" minOccurs="0"/> <element name="TelephoneNumberFilter" type="{urn:oasis:names:tc:ebxml-regrep:xsd:query:3.0}FilterType" maxOccurs="unbounded" minOccurs="0"/> <element name="EmailAddressFilter" type="{urn:oasis:names:tc:ebxml-regrep:xsd:query:3.0}FilterType" maxOccurs="unbounded" minOccurs="0"/> <element name="ParentQuery" type="{urn:oasis:names:tc:ebxml-regrep:xsd:query:3.0}OrganizationQueryType" minOccurs="0"/> <element name="ChildOrganizationQuery" type="{urn:oasis:names:tc:ebxml-regrep:xsd:query:3.0}OrganizationQueryType" maxOccurs="unbounded" minOccurs="0"/> <element name="PrimaryContactQuery" type="{urn:oasis:names:tc:ebxml-regrep:xsd:query:3.0}PersonQueryType" minOccurs="0"/> </sequence> </extension> </complexContent> </complexType>
Modifier and Type | Field and Description |
---|---|
protected List<FilterType> |
addressFilter |
protected List<OrganizationQueryType> |
childOrganizationQuery |
protected List<FilterType> |
emailAddressFilter |
protected OrganizationQueryType |
parentQuery |
protected PersonQueryType |
primaryContactQuery |
protected List<FilterType> |
telephoneNumberFilter |
classificationQuery, descriptionBranch, externalIdentifierQuery, nameBranch, objectTypeQuery, slotBranch, sourceAssociationQuery, statusQuery, targetAssociationQuery, versionInfoFilter
primaryFilter
Constructor and Description |
---|
OrganizationQueryType() |
Modifier and Type | Method and Description |
---|---|
List<FilterType> |
getAddressFilter()
Gets the value of the addressFilter property.
|
List<OrganizationQueryType> |
getChildOrganizationQuery()
Gets the value of the childOrganizationQuery property.
|
List<FilterType> |
getEmailAddressFilter()
Gets the value of the emailAddressFilter property.
|
OrganizationQueryType |
getParentQuery()
Gets the value of the parentQuery property.
|
PersonQueryType |
getPrimaryContactQuery()
Gets the value of the primaryContactQuery property.
|
List<FilterType> |
getTelephoneNumberFilter()
Gets the value of the telephoneNumberFilter property.
|
void |
setParentQuery(OrganizationQueryType value)
Sets the value of the parentQuery property.
|
void |
setPrimaryContactQuery(PersonQueryType value)
Sets the value of the primaryContactQuery property.
|
getClassificationQuery, getDescriptionBranch, getExternalIdentifierQuery, getNameBranch, getObjectTypeQuery, getSlotBranch, getSourceAssociationQuery, getStatusQuery, getTargetAssociationQuery, getVersionInfoFilter, setDescriptionBranch, setNameBranch, setObjectTypeQuery, setStatusQuery, setVersionInfoFilter
getPrimaryFilter, setPrimaryFilter
protected List<FilterType> addressFilter
protected List<FilterType> telephoneNumberFilter
protected List<FilterType> emailAddressFilter
protected OrganizationQueryType parentQuery
protected List<OrganizationQueryType> childOrganizationQuery
protected PersonQueryType primaryContactQuery
public List<FilterType> getAddressFilter()
This accessor method returns a reference to the live list,
not a snapshot. Therefore any modification you make to the
returned list will be present inside the JAXB object.
This is why there is not a set
method for the addressFilter property.
For example, to add a new item, do as follows:
getAddressFilter().add(newItem);
Objects of the following type(s) are allowed in the list
FilterType
public List<FilterType> getTelephoneNumberFilter()
This accessor method returns a reference to the live list,
not a snapshot. Therefore any modification you make to the
returned list will be present inside the JAXB object.
This is why there is not a set
method for the telephoneNumberFilter property.
For example, to add a new item, do as follows:
getTelephoneNumberFilter().add(newItem);
Objects of the following type(s) are allowed in the list
FilterType
public List<FilterType> getEmailAddressFilter()
This accessor method returns a reference to the live list,
not a snapshot. Therefore any modification you make to the
returned list will be present inside the JAXB object.
This is why there is not a set
method for the emailAddressFilter property.
For example, to add a new item, do as follows:
getEmailAddressFilter().add(newItem);
Objects of the following type(s) are allowed in the list
FilterType
public OrganizationQueryType getParentQuery()
OrganizationQueryType
public void setParentQuery(OrganizationQueryType value)
value
- allowed object is
OrganizationQueryType
public List<OrganizationQueryType> getChildOrganizationQuery()
This accessor method returns a reference to the live list,
not a snapshot. Therefore any modification you make to the
returned list will be present inside the JAXB object.
This is why there is not a set
method for the childOrganizationQuery property.
For example, to add a new item, do as follows:
getChildOrganizationQuery().add(newItem);
Objects of the following type(s) are allowed in the list
OrganizationQueryType
public PersonQueryType getPrimaryContactQuery()
PersonQueryType
public void setPrimaryContactQuery(PersonQueryType value)
value
- allowed object is
PersonQueryType
Copyright © 2018 Open eHealth Foundation. All rights reserved.